Missing or corrupted python.dll file: The python.dll file is a crucial component of Mod Organizer’s Python plugin. If this file is missing or corrupted, Mod Organizer will fail to load the plugin. Outdated or incompatible Python version: Mod Organizer requires a specific version of Python to function correctly. If your Python version is outdated or incompatible, you may encounter this error. Incorrect plugin configuration: If the plugin configuration is incorrect or incomplete, Mod Organizer may fail to load the Python plugin.
